The cheapest way to get from St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station) is to drive which costs $8 - $13 and takes 37 min.
The fastest way to get from St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station) is to drive which takes 37 min and costs $8 - $13.
No, there is no direct bus from St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station). However, there are services departing from Shirlow Ave/Point Nepean Rd and arriving at Frankston via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 25m.
The distance between St Andrews Beach and Frankston (Station) is 52 km. The road distance is 47.4 km.
The best way to get from St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station) without a car is to bus which takes 1h 25m and costs $25 - $29.
It takes approximately 1h 25m to get from St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station), including transfers.
St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station) bus services, operated by Metropolitan buses, depart from Shirlow Ave/Point Nepean Rd station.
St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station) bus services, operated by Metropolitan buses, arrive at Frankston station.
Yes, the driving distance between St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station) is 47 km. It takes approximately 37 min to drive from St Andrews Beach to Frankston (Station).

What companies run services between St Andrews Beach, VIC, Australia and Frankston (Station), VIC, Australia?
Metropolitan buses operates a bus from Shirlow Ave/Point Nepean Rd to Frankston every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$6 and the journey takes 1h 15m.
